Preparation: Produced from sera of goats immunized with highly pure Recombinant Human TPO. Anti-Human TPO-specific antibody was purified by affinity chromatography and then biotinylated. Sandwich ELISA: To detect hTPO by sandwich ELISA (using 100 μL/well antibody solution) a concentration of 0.25-1.0 μg/mL of this antibody is required. This biotinylated polyclonal antibody, in conjunction with PeproTech Polyclonal Anti-Human TPO (500-P49G) as a capture antibody, allows the detection of at least 0.2-0.4 ng/well of Recombinant hTPO. Western Blot: To detect hTPO by Western Blot analysis this antibody can be used at a concentration of 0.1-0.2 μg/mL. Used in conjunction with compatible secondary reagents the detection limit for Recombinant hTPO is 1.5-3.0 ng/lane, under either reducing or non-reducing conditions. 500-P49GBT-1MG will be provided as 2 x 500 μg
Thrombopoietin (TPO, THPO, MPL ligand, megakaryocyte colony-stimulating factor) is responsible for the generation of platelets through its action on hematopoietic cells committed to the megakaryocyte lineage. Binding of thrombopoietin to its receptor, MPL (CD110), initiates a signaling cascade via JAK/STAT, MAPK, and PI3K/AKT signaling pathways that leads to the proliferation and differentiation of megakaryocytes and, μgtimately, to the production of platelets (thrombopoiesis). Thrombopoietin is constitutively produced by the liver and has a predicted molecular weight of 38 kDa.Specifications
